GLEN EIRA: Will there be a new home for Big Frog mural?
Glen Eira Council says that it is try to work on a solution for the popular Big Frog mural that was removed from Murrumbeena.
“The Story of Big Frog mural, a much-loved community project, was created in 2020-21 by artist Anthony Breslin in collaboration with the Caulfield Rotary Club, Murrumbeena Traders Association, and the local community,” a Council representative said.
“Council supported the project with a community grant that part funded this vibrant addition to Murrumbeena.
“While the mural’s removal last year was disappointing for the community, we were not involved in the decision to remove it and we do not believe it to be an act of vandalism.
“We’ve been actively engaging with stakeholders since the removal and are exploring options to relocate the original tiles, in part or in full, to a new location within the Murrumbeena community.
“Council is committed to exploring options for this important piece of community art and will continue working with Anthony Breslin to endeavour to find a new home for the mural, whether in full or in part,” the representative said.
